Thorough Competitor Analysis: The Foundation of Success

A firm foundation is necessary before going on the path to steal your competitors’ audience. A thorough competitive study is the foundation of your approach. Investigate their demographics, content tactics, social media presence, and ways of engagement. SEMrush, Ahrefs, and BuzzSumo are just a few of the tools that can help you learn about your competitors’ digital footprint. Recognize what appeals to their target audience and where they may be falling short. This insight enables you to create a targeted approach that not only addresses the audience of your competitors but also highlights your unique value offer. A thorough awareness of your competitors’ strengths and shortcomings allows you to strategically position your brand, making it easier to attract, engage, and convert the target audience.

Strategic Advertising: Targeted Outreach

In the quest to attract your competitors’ audience, strategic advertising plays a pivotal role. Utilize tools such as Google Ads and social media to execute precisely targeted campaigns. Create appealing ad language and imagery that directly target your competitors’ audience’s pain points and objectives.

Utilize the information gleaned from competitor analysis to fine-tune your targeting criteria. Set demographics, hobbies, and behaviors that closely match your target audience. By strategically putting your advertising where your competitors’ audience frequents, you boost your chances of gaining their attention.

Make sure your messaging emphasizes your unique value proposition, demonstrating how your solutions stand out from the throng. A/B test your advertising to improve their performance and modify your strategy over time.

Remember, the goal is to build resonance and conversion, not merely grab attention. Your smart advertising should excite attention while also leading to landing sites that provide clear solutions and opportunity for participation. Your advertising can be the digital signposts that guide your competitors’ audience to discovering the value your brand delivers to their lives through focused outreach.
